We have had this tent for a year now and have enjoyed both summer and winter camping in it ( we\'re a hardy bunch!) We have the footprint groundsheet and carpet which really keeps the warmth in when the temperature drops outside. Its a complete doddle to put up, I do it with my 3 boys in about half an hour (it obviously takes a bit longer to get the guys properly pegged out) We love this tent and it fits my whole family of 9 around a table playing cards in the evening when the campfire has faded. I\'m thinking of getting the canopy for our next trip at easter so we can cook under cover.

Not being an enthusiastic camper I was out for comfort. A sewn in ground sheet, space and a spare room was important.
We practiced putting it up in the local scout hut before we went and was surprised how easy it was and because the ground sheet was sewn in
it was dryer and warmer. However we could not fit on some of the sites we liked the look of because of its size.
Rather have the space though and a limmited number of sites. I would reccomend buying the canopy as well as you can stay dry
when cooking and we are going to be really indulgent this year and by the carpet.

You may ask how big we are going to go with our Hartford’s? Last year we launched Hartford XXL with the large central living area and four generous sleeping cabins! Demand for the Hartford XXL exceeded all limits so here it is again with lots of space for lots of people or a great tent for those who need extra rooms for storage. With two entrances, four large, rainproof ventilation points, internal organizer pockets and many more useful features make this tent ideal for family camping holidays.
Specifications:
Tenttype:
Five room dome tent
Pitching way:
Inner tent first
Flysheet:
Outtex® 5000 with taped seams
Hydrostatic head:
5000
Inner tent:
Breathable polyester
Floor:
Double-coated polyethylene
Poles:
Durawrap fibreglass 12.7 mm. Steel poles 19,0 mm
Accessories:
2 upright steel poles
PackSize:
72 x 40
Weight:
32.60
Recommended for:
For all those who want a big closed living area plus four side rooms
Features:
• Mud valance on storage area
• Innovative carrier bag with wet gear compartment
• Skylight window
• Fully seam-sealed flysheet for maximum protection
• Double entrance allows ease of access
• “D” shaped zipped inner doors with No-See-Um mesh
• Reinforcement patch on all stress points
• Entrance with large windows
• Adjustable pegging points
• Lamp holder and internal pockets for storage
